Output 067213ae5c8424be8af62e6b9e2b6de81398b7493b48c4335b7e7e8e073b4cf9:7

value
1052500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bf8757094e2f383635509b0ab435e6d42c41535 OP_EQUAL
address
34EuowTRuqYXVzMgfu36mbKpd7s2SKcyoB
transaction
067213ae5c8424be8af62e6b9e2b6de81398b7493b48c4335b7e7e8e073b4cf9
spent
true